الضرجع

Root entry · 2 derived lemmas

This root appears to be very limited in its usage, primarily referring to a specific type of wild cat. Its derived forms are not common in classical or modern Arabic.

Derived headwords

الضِرْجَعnoun
  1. 1.
    leopardclassical

    A large, powerful wild cat, specifically a leopard.

الضَرْعَجnoun
  1. 1.
    leopardclassical

    An alternative form or pronunciation for the leopard.

Parallel reading

الضِرْجَع، كجعفر: النمر.
The dirja', like ja'far: the leopard.
